helmeted

Variant of helmet

noun

  1. a protective covering for the head; specif.,
    1. the headpiece of ancient or medieval armor
    2. the metal head covering worn in modern warfare
    3. the rigid head covering with inner padding and often a wire face mask used in football, lacrosse, and hockey
    4. the mesh-faced mask used in fencing
    5. the headpiece of a diver's suit, equipped with air tubes, glass windows, etc.
    6. a fireman's protective hat
    7. a pith hat with a wide brim, worn as a sunshade in hot countries
    8. the rigid head covering worn by a motorcyclist
    9. hard hat
  2. something suggesting such a headpiece in appearance or function, as a galea of a flower

transitive verb

to cover or equip with a helmet
